He received the basic training on the instrument sitar in the traditional style from Dr. Ram Chakravarty, professor at Benares Hindu University and exponent of the Varanasi-Seniya-Gharana. In 1989 the Swiss sitar player obtained the "Sangit Prabhakar diploma on sitar", which he passed with distinction. Since 1991 he has also been dealing with Indian classical singing (Dhrupad, Khyal) and musicology etc. at Dr. Ritwik Sanyal (over 5 years teaching in Varanasi, India). He regularly gives concerts and workshops in India, Nepal and Europe. Appearances on Nepalese television and tour with the Indian catholic dancer Durga Arya. 1997 Concert at the Süddeutscher Rundfunk in the SDR Kulturforum. With introductions to Indian music, he also acts as a mediator of Indian music culture.
